French Tennis Stars Ugo Humbert and Arthur Fils Set for Historic Australian Open Clash
For the first time in nearly a decade, two French players will face off in the third round of the Australian Open, with a spot in the fourth round on the line.
- Ugo Humbert, ranked 14th in the ATP rankings, advanced to the third round after a straight-sets victory over qualifier Hady Habib (6-3, 6-4, 6-4).
- Arthur Fils, ranked 21st, secured his spot in the third round by defeating compatriot Quentin Halys in a rain-interrupted four-set match (6-2, 4-6, 7-6(2), 7-5).
- This marks the first time since 2016 that two French players will meet in the third round of a Grand Slam and the first such occurrence at the Australian Open in nine years.
- Humbert holds a 3-1 head-to-head record against Fils, though Fils won their most recent encounter in the Tokyo final after saving a match point.
- The winner of this all-French duel will advance to the fourth round, keeping French hopes alive in the tournament's later stages.
